Accommodation

There are 33 hotels in Crans-Montana, mainly upmarket ones. There are two 5-star hotels new for 2009-2010, Le Crans Hotel and Spa (00 41 27 486 60 60) and Hotel Guarda Golf (00 41 27 486 20 00). Most are large and comfortable, and there are many chalets.

Most accommodation is a bus ride or car journey from the lifts but if you want to be close then try Hotel Alpina and Savoy (00 41 27 485 09 00), Hotel Art de Vivre (00 41 27 481 33 12), Hotel Etrier (00 41 27 485 44 00) or Le Crans Hotel and Spa (00 41 27 486 60 60) which also has a great restaurant and superb views.

If you are after saving a few pennies, an English couple, Karen and Gary Tansley, have opened a bed and breakfast at Chalet des Alpes (00 41 27 483 23 09). The 2-star Hotel Olympic (00 41 27 481 29 85) is also a good budget option.

Non-ski activities

There are plenty of activities for non-skiers and if you are prepared to venture further afield; Sierre and Sion down in the valley are worth a visit and are easy to get to. 

In Crans-Montana many of the hotels have swimming pools and wellness centres, while there are two ice rinks, dog sledding, snow tubing, a cinema and a casino. 

There is also good walking and cross-country skiing with 65km of marked trails.

Childcare

There are good childcare facilities up the mountain with a snow garden and nursery above Montana, while the golf course in town transforms into a beginners area with activities for the young ones.

There’s also a special kids area in the forest by the lake with slides, swings and easy ropeways that are open all year round.
